Eukarpia

deity earth Greek single tradition · 1

In ancient Greek religion and myth, Eukarpia ("well-fruited" or "She of the rich harvest") was a divine personification of fertility, or an epithet or cult title for a deity. In Gonnoi, Thessaly, Eukarpia appears as a name for invoking Ge (Earth).
